The second sentence describes snakes (1) When it comes to poisonous snakes, everyone thinks of cobras, but sea snakes living in the sea are more poisonous than cobras. Sea snakes have bright patterns, small scales and thick skin, a flat tail like an oar, a particularly small head and a mouthful of fangs. It has a valve in its nostril. When it inhales enough air, the valve closes and it can stay at the bottom of the sea for a long time. Sea snakes have salt glands under their tongues, which can discharge excess salt from their bodies. Sea snakes have large lungs, which can store a lot of air and adjust their ups and downs. It likes swimming at sea in the evening and at night.

Sentence 3 describing snakes: Snakes (scientific name: Serpenthes) belong to the phylum Chordata and Reptilia. The body is slender and divided into three parts: head, trunk and tail. There are no limbs or claw-like hind limbs on both sides of the transverse fissure of the lower snake. Full of scales; The head has different shapes, and the nostril is located on the snout side, but the Hydraceae species that live in the sea for life are located on the snout back; There is protective transparent skin outside the eyeball, the pupil is round, vertical oval or horizontal oval, there is no movable eyelid, and the crystal is almost spherical; The tongue is slender and forked; The premolars (only snakes in the family Serpentidae have teeth), maxilla, palatine bone, pterygoid bone and dentate bone of snakes are attached with teeth with curved tips, but the size, number and structure of teeth vary with different snake species. The tail is obviously shorter than the head.

The habitat of snakes varies from species to species. Some live in caves, some live on the ground, some live in trees and some live in water. The snake is a kind of temperature-changing animal whose body temperature changes with the temperature, because the snake itself has no perfect temperature regulation mechanism to generate and maintain a constant body temperature. Snakes are carnivores and eat many kinds of animals, from invertebrates to all kinds of vertebrates. Distributed in all parts of the earth except the north and south poles.

Snakes are a special biological group formed by long-term evolution of 654.38+0.3 billion years, which plays an important role in maintaining ecological balance. Snakes belong to a kind of temperature-changing animals, with a low degree of evolution, and their distribution and survival are greatly affected by climate, so they are a fragile biological group.

According to the collection of rare database, there are 3,425 species of snakes in the world, and there are 24 1 species in China. According to Zhao's Snakes in China, there are 205 kinds of snakes in China. With the deepening of field investigation, new species and new records of snakes in China are increasing.

History of zoology

Snakes are the latest group in the evolutionary history of reptiles, and the earliest snake fossils were unearthed in the Mesozoic Cretaceous strata more than 70 million years ago. Snakes and lizards are close relatives. Many scholars have found through research that the scales on the body surface of primitive snakes of the family Lepidoptera are banded, and the scales on the abdomen are small but not obvious. The skulls such as maxilla, palatine bone and pterygoid bone are closely connected, and the square bone is short, which limits the extreme opening of Shekou. The mandible retains the coronal bone; There are black beaks and bones. The forked tongue of Iguanidae, the spinal structure of Iguanidae, and the peptide fingerprints produced by hemoglobin hydrolysis are all similar to snakes. More importantly, among lizards, there are not only species of Anguilla and Amphioxus whose limbs degenerate into snakes, but also the process of gradually shortening the length of limbs until they shrink and disappear in different kinds of lizards. These examples irrefutably prove that snakes originated from lizards and evolved from the trunk of lizards with the extension and absence of limbs.
